Ridge回归 sklearn API参数速查手册

简介: Ridge回归 sklearn API参数速查手册

语法

sklearn.linear_model.Ridge(alpha=1.0,
fit_intercept=True, normalize=False,
copy_X=True, max_iter=None, tol=0.001, 
solver='auto', random_state=None)

Parameters


alpha


释义: 正则化项系数,较大的值指定更强的正则化


设置:Alpha对应于其他线性模型(如Logistic回归或LinearSVC)中的C^-1。如果传递数组,则假定惩罚被特定于目标。因此,它们必须在数量上对应。


fit_intercept


释义:是否计算该模型的截距


设置:bool型,可选,默认True;如果使用中心化的数据,可以考虑设置为False,不考虑截距


normalize


释义:是否对数据进行标准化处理,若不计算截距,则忽略此参数


设置:bool型,可选,默认False,建议将标准化的工作放在训练模型之前,通过设置

sklearn.preprocessing.StandardScaler来实现,而在此处设置为false;当fit_intercept设置为false的时候,这个参数会被自动忽略。如果为True,回归器会标准化输入参数:减去平均值,并且除以相应的二范数


copy_X


释义:是否对X复制


设置:bool型、可选、默认True;如为false,则即经过中心化,标准化后,把新数据覆盖到原数据X上


max_iter


释义:共轭梯度求解器的最大迭代次数,需要与solver求解器配合使用


设置:solver为sparse_cg和lsqr时,默认由scipy.sparse.linalg确定,solver为sag时,默认值为1000


tol


释义:计算精度


设置:float型,默认=1e-3


solver


释义:求解器{auto,svd,cholesky,lsqr,sparse_cg,sag,saga}


设置:


aotu:根据数据类型自动选择求解器


svd:使用X的奇异值分解计算岭系数,奇异矩阵比cholesky更稳定


cholesky:使用标准的scipy.linalg.solve函数获得收敛的系数


sparse_cg:使用scipy.sparse.linalg.cg中的共轭梯度求解器。比cholesky更适合大规模数据(设置tol和max_iter的可能性)


lsqr:专用的正则化最小二乘方法scipy.sparse.linalg.lsqr


sag:随机平均梯度下降;仅在fit_intercept为True时支持密集数据


saga:sag改进,无偏版.采用SAGA梯度下降法可以使模型快速收敛


random_state


释义:随机数生成器的种子,仅在solver="sag"时使用


设置:int型, 默认None


Attributes


coef_


返回模型的估计系数(权重向量)


intercept_


线性模型的独立项,一维情形下的截距


n_iter_


实际迭代次数


Methods


fit(self, X, y[, sample_weight])


输入训练样本数据X,和对应的标记y


get_params(self[, deep])


返回函数linear_model.Ridge()内部的参数值


predict(self, X)


利用学习好的线性分类器,预测标记


score(self, X, y[, sample_weight])


返回模型的拟合优度判定系数


set_params(self, **params)


设置函数linear_model.Ridge()内部的参数

相关文章
|
7月前
|
人工智能 缓存 API
谷歌发布MediaPipe LLM Inference API,28亿参数模型本地跑
【2月更文挑战第24天】谷歌发布MediaPipe LLM Inference API,28亿参数模型本地跑
283 3
谷歌发布MediaPipe LLM Inference API,28亿参数模型本地跑
|
7月前
|
存储 算法 关系型数据库
实时计算 Flink版产品使用合集之在Flink Stream API中,可以在任务启动时初始化一些静态的参数并将其存储在内存中吗
实时计算Flink版作为一种强大的流处理和批处理统一的计算框架,广泛应用于各种需要实时数据处理和分析的场景。实时计算Flink版通常结合SQL接口、DataStream API、以及与上下游数据源和存储系统的丰富连接器,提供了一套全面的解决方案,以应对各种实时计算需求。其低延迟、高吞吐、容错性强的特点,使其成为众多企业和组织实时数据处理首选的技术平台。以下是实时计算Flink版的一些典型使用合集。
129 4
|
1月前
|
Java API PHP
阿里巴巴参数获取API
阿里巴巴的参数获取API流程包括:1. 注册并认证开发者账号;2. 创建应用,获取API密钥;3. 阅读API文档,了解请求参数和返回格式;4. 编写代码调用API,如使用Python请求商品详情;5. 注意API类型及其参数,遵守数据使用规则和法律法规。
|
2月前
|
缓存 负载均衡 API
抖音抖店API请求获取宝贝详情数据、原价、销量、主图等参数可支持高并发调用接入演示
这是一个使用Python编写的示例代码,用于从抖音抖店API获取商品详情,包括原价、销量和主图等信息。示例展示了如何构建请求、处理响应及提取所需数据。针对高并发场景,建议采用缓存、限流、负载均衡、异步处理及代码优化等策略,以提升性能和稳定性。
|
2月前
|
Java API 开发工具
API参考手册
【10月更文挑战第18天】API参考手册
49 2
|
2月前
|
JavaScript API
|
2月前
|
缓存 监控 API
微服务架构下RESTful风格api实践中,我为何抛弃了路由参数 - 用简单设计来提速
本文探讨了 RESTful API 设计中的两种路径方案:动态路径和固定路径。动态路径通过路径参数实现资源的 CRUD 操作,而固定路径则通过查询参数和不同的 HTTP 方法实现相同功能。固定路径设计提高了安全性、路由匹配速度和 API 的可维护性,但也可能增加 URL 长度并降低表达灵活性。通过对比测试,固定路径在性能上表现更优,适合微服务架构下的 API 设计。
|
2月前
|
机器学习/深度学习 算法 数据可视化
【机器学习】决策树------迅速了解其基本思想,Sklearn的决策树API及构建决策树的步骤!!!
【机器学习】决策树------迅速了解其基本思想,Sklearn的决策树API及构建决策树的步骤!!!
|
4月前
|
运维 Serverless API
函数计算产品使用问题之如何通过API传递ControlNet参数
函数计算产品作为一种事件驱动的全托管计算服务,让用户能够专注于业务逻辑的编写,而无需关心底层服务器的管理与运维。你可以有效地利用函数计算产品来支撑各类应用场景,从简单的数据处理到复杂的业务逻辑,实现快速、高效、低成本的云上部署与运维。以下是一些关于使用函数计算产品的合集和要点,帮助你更好地理解和应用这一服务。
|
4月前
|
测试技术 API
【API管理 APIM】如何查看APIM中的Request与Response详细信息,如Header,Body中的参数内容
【API管理 APIM】如何查看APIM中的Request与Response详细信息,如Header,Body中的参数内容